What is Saddle Stitch Book Printing?
Saddle stitch book printing is a popular printing method to bind small booklets, brochures, magazines, and catalogues. This binding technique involves folding sheets of paper in half and then stapling them along the fold, which is often referred to as the spine.
Saddle stitch book binding is preferred for its simplicity and cost efficiency, making it excellent for short-run publications like event programs, menus, and other multi-page documents where a fancy binding is unnecessary.

Our Saddle Stitch Book Printing Process
- Choose Your Template or Custom Design
- Select Your Specifications (size, paper, quantity)
- Proofing and Revisions
- Printing: The booklet pages are printed on large sheets, typically with multiple pages per sheet laid out so that they are in the correct order when folded.
- Folding: After printing, the sheets are folded in half, known as “signatures.”
- Stapling: Metal staples are inserted along the fold line from the outside, securing the sheets together. The number of staples used can vary but typically ranges from two to three depending on the booklet thickness.
- Rimming: Once stapled, the other three sides of the booklet may be trimmed to give a clean, even edge.

What is saddle stitch binding?
Saddle stitch binding is a method of bookbinding where folded sheets of paper are stapled through the fold line with wire staples. This economical and straightforward binding technique is commonly used for smaller booklets, magazines, and brochures.
How many pages can a saddle stitch book have?
Saddle stitching is ideal for small booklets ranging from a few pages up to about 64 pages, depending on the paperweight.
